I have the following problem - one of my clients (a Danish home improvement company) decided to block all the international traffic (leaving only Scandiavian one), because they were getting a lot of spammers using their mail form to send e-mails.
As you can guess this lead to blocking Google also since the servers of Google Denmark are located in the US. This lead to drop in their rankings. So my question is - What Shall I do now - wait or contact Google?

One of our clients did this once. We restored the robots.txt to original version allowing robots to browse normally and pointed a few fresh links to the site. The site was back in the index within a week. If your site has thousands or millions of pages that may take a bit longer. We found that discovery through links leads to better and quicker indexation than when you simply submit to Google. Get Google Webmaster Tools account and ensure that Google has clear picture of your site.
